Danger Booster #2: Valsalva Pushing
The Valsalva maneuver is customary in hospitals and is what you normally see in motion pictures and reveals. You’re in mattress together with your legs in stirrups. Then, you maintain your breath and push to the rely of ten.
This system is nice for the physician however troublesome for you and your child. It lowers everybody’s oxygen ranges, decreasing blood circulation to the uterus, your child, and tissues that should be comfortable for start.
Danger Booster #3: Pressured Pushing at 10 cm
Most care suppliers need you to start out pushing once you hit 10 cm…
…however your physique and child might not be prepared for pushing. Letting your child transfer down a bit provides the tissues of your perineum time to open.
If you wait to push till you are feeling the urge, and solely push the way you need, you’re extra more likely to start your child gently!
